Torqeedo Wins Electric Boat Race in Maryland
#1
Solidifying its place as the leader in electric propulsion, Torqeedo recently won first, second and third places in the 12th annual Wye Island Electric Boat Marathon in St. Michaels, Maryland. This year nine contestants took on the 24-mile race to circumnavigate Wye Island using only electric motors.

Torqeedo was able to take the top three spots because it manufactures the most efficient electric outboard motors in the marketplace. Higher overall efficiencies result in more power and more range, allowing boats to travel with a lower battery weight and greater speeds than traditional electric motors.

First place went to Ned Farinholt with Erged-On II, a 19' custom runabout powered by a Torqeedo Cruise 4.0 Remote motor. He finished with a record-setting time of 2 hours, 7 minutes and an average speed of 12mph. Second place was taken by Dr. James Campbell and his 20' OldTown Canoe, which was propelled by a Torqeedo Cruise 4.0 Tiller motor. He came in with a time of 2 hours, 27 minutes and an average speed of 10mph.

Rounding out the top three was Capt. Todd Sims of ePower Marine and his Saturn 16' inflatable powered by a Torqeedo Cruise 2.0 Tiller motor. He finished the race in 2 hours, 43 minutes with an average speed of 9mph.
